Understanding Nocturnal Animals
Nocturnal animals are those that are most active during the night and rest or sleep during the day. This behavior is driven by various factors, including the need to avoid predators, the availability of food, and the need to conserve energy. Nocturnal animals have evolved specialized senses and behaviors to help them navigate in low-light conditions.
Adaptations of Nocturnal Animals
Nocturnal animals have developed several adaptations to thrive in the dark. These adaptations include enhanced senses, specialized physical features, and unique behaviors. Some of the key adaptations are:
- Enhanced Vision: Many nocturnal animals have large eyes with a high concentration of rod cells, which are sensitive to low light. This allows them to see better in the dark.
- Keen Hearing: Some nocturnal animals, like bats and owls, have exceptional hearing abilities. This helps them detect prey and navigate their environment.
- Sensitive Smell: Animals like foxes and raccoons rely on their keen sense of smell to locate food and detect predators.
- Specialized Physical Features: Some nocturnal animals have unique physical features, such as the reflective layer behind the retina in cats, which enhances their night vision.
Examples of Nocturnal Animals
There is a wide variety of nocturnal animals across different species. Some of the most well-known examples include:
- Mammals: Bats, foxes, raccoons, and opossums are common nocturnal mammals. Bats use echolocation to navigate and hunt insects, while foxes and raccoons rely on their keen senses to find food.
- Birds: Owls are perhaps the most famous nocturnal birds. Their large eyes and silent flight make them formidable hunters in the night.
- Reptiles: Some snakes, like the rattlesnake, are nocturnal. They use their heat-sensing pits to detect warm-blooded prey in the dark.
- Insects: Many insects, such as moths and fireflies, are active at night. Moths use their antennae to detect pheromones, while fireflies use bioluminescence to communicate.
Behavioral Patterns of Nocturnal Animals
Nocturnal animals exhibit a range of behaviors that help them survive and thrive in the dark. These behaviors include:
- Hunting and Foraging: Many nocturnal animals are predators or scavengers. They use their enhanced senses to locate prey or carrion in the dark.
- Communication: Some nocturnal animals use vocalizations, pheromones, or bioluminescence to communicate with each other. For example, fireflies use their glowing abdomens to attract mates.
- Resting and Sleeping: Nocturnal animals often rest or sleep during the day. They may hide in burrows, trees, or other sheltered areas to avoid predators and conserve energy.
Ecological Importance of Nocturnal Animals
Nocturnal animals play a crucial role in maintaining the balance of ecosystems. They help control insect populations, disperse seeds, and recycle nutrients. For example, bats are important pollinators and seed dispersers, while owls help control rodent populations. The presence of nocturnal animals indicates a healthy ecosystem, as they are often sensitive to environmental changes.
Challenges Faced by Nocturnal Animals
Despite their adaptations, nocturnal animals face several challenges. These include:
- Habitat Loss: Urbanization and deforestation destroy the habitats of many nocturnal animals, leading to population declines.
- Light Pollution: Artificial light can disrupt the natural behaviors of nocturnal animals, making it difficult for them to navigate and find food.
- Predation: Some nocturnal animals are preyed upon by other animals, including humans. Hunting and trapping can significantly reduce their populations.
Conservation Efforts for Nocturnal Animals
Conservation efforts are essential to protect nocturnal animals and their habitats. Some key strategies include:
- Habitat Protection: Establishing protected areas and restoring habitats can help preserve the natural environments of nocturnal animals.
- Reducing Light Pollution: Implementing measures to reduce light pollution, such as using motion-sensor lights and shielding outdoor lighting, can help nocturnal animals thrive.
- Education and Awareness: Raising awareness about the importance of nocturnal animals and the threats they face can encourage public support for conservation efforts.

Nocturnal Animals and Human Interaction
Nocturnal animals often interact with humans in various ways. Some of these interactions are beneficial, while others can be problematic. For example, bats help control insect populations, but they can also carry diseases like rabies. Understanding these interactions can help us coexist with nocturnal animals more harmoniously.
Nocturnal Animals and Urban Environments
As urbanization continues, many nocturnal animals are adapting to live in urban environments. Some species, like raccoons and opossums, have become quite common in cities. However, urban environments present unique challenges for nocturnal animals, including light pollution, habitat fragmentation, and increased human-wildlife conflicts.
Nocturnal Animals and Climate Change
Climate change is affecting the habitats and behaviors of many nocturnal animals. Rising temperatures, changing precipitation patterns, and increased frequency of extreme weather events can disrupt the natural cycles of nocturnal animals, making it difficult for them to find food and reproduce. Understanding these impacts is crucial for developing effective conservation strategies.
